Fog Lake and Oyama announced to support Foxing on UK tour

Foxing have announced Canadian act Fog Lake and Iceland’s Oyama to be supporting them on their upcoming UK dates next year in March 2017. The former lo-fi group will be playing the majority of the dates, whilst the latter dream pop band will only play a few select shows.

Pijn announce debut record, ‘Floodlit’

Manchester post rock/metal group Pijn have announced the release of their debut record, ‘Floodlit’. Featuring current/ex members of Old Skin and Doctrines, the band are recommended for fans of Mogwai, Russian Circles and Godspeed You! Black Emperor. It will be released on the 27th January 2017 via Holy Roar

Mammoth Weed Wizard Bastard announce UK tour with Ohhms

Welsh doom crew Mammoth Weed Wizard Bastard have announced an extensive UK tour alongside Kent based Ohmms. The tour will take place in February 2017 following the release of MWWB’s second album ‘Y Proffwyd Dwyll’ that was released earlier this year via New Heavy Sounds.
